Troubleshooting Viron Pool Chlorinator Cells: Common Issues & Solutions
Dealing with a malfunctioning Viron pool chlorinator cell can be frustrating, but many issues are relatively straightforward to fix . Common obstacles often stem from scaling, insufficient chlorine levels, or a faulty energy supply. One frequent complaint is reduced chlorination; this could be caused by calcium buildup – try descaling the cell with a dedicated descaling solution following the manufacturer's directions. Alternatively, check your salt level ; a measurement that's too high or too minimal can impact cell operation . Inspect the cell's wiring and terminals to ensure a secure link ; a loose conductor can disrupt power. If the difficulty persists after these procedures, it's best to consult a certified pool technician for further diagnosis or consider cell change.
- Scaling: Descale with a specific solution.
- Salt Level: Check and adjust salt concentration.
- Power Supply: Inspect wiring and connections.
